What a carrier-based gateway API provides
A carrier-based fintech integration connects your systems directly to the mobile money rails used by customers. With the MTN ecosystem, the goal is to create a dependable payment gateway workflow that can collect and disburse funds through programmable endpoints. This is especially useful for Secured Global Multi-currency wallet platforms that need to accept payments from multiple regions, or run recurring collections such as subscriptions and service fees. When the gateway handles the technical transaction steps, your team focuses on business logic and customer experience.
With an API approach, you can build structured payment flows: initiate a payment, monitor its status, and confirm outcomes for accounting. You can also implement disbursement features for payouts such as vendor settlements, refunds, or merchant commissions. Integration steps with secure workflow and testing
Start by mapping your payment journey: where the user initiates payment, what data you capture, and how you display confirmations. Then prepare your backend to create payment requests, listen for callbacks, and verify transaction results. A good integration plan includes defining the exact events your system must respond to, such as “payment initiated,” “payment successful,” or “payment failed.” This prevents mismatches between what the customer sees and what your ledger records.
Security should be treated as part of the design, not an afterthought. Use secure authentication practices, validate signatures for callbacks, and restrict access to API credentials. Implement idempotency controls so that repeated requests do not create duplicate charges. Finally, run test cycles that cover edge cases like timeouts, partial failures, and user cancellation, so your customer-facing flows remain consistent even under real-world conditions.
